About the Role.

This role will provide stellar customer service to our clients while processing claims in a timely and accurate manner. 

Responsibilities.

  • Consistently hit quarterly Big 3 goals while embodying our CARE values.
  • Provide stellar customer service to providers, clients and participants  
  • Responsible for handling all COBRA accounts, including payments and correspondence with clients
  • Respond to all COBRA inquiries via email and phone within ThrivePass SLAs
  • Process qualifying event notices, election forms, coverage changes and termination letters
  • Acquire a thorough understanding of key customer needs and requirements
  • Provide on-going assistance to team members
  • Meet production standards for claims and call handling
  • Meet quality standards for COBRA claims, calls, file processing and other work

Requirements.

  • 1-2 years’ experience as a claims or COBRA administrator, customer service, phone support or similar field
  • Must have experience working with COBRAPoint 
  • Familiar with standard insurance concepts, practices and procedures
  • Strong knowledge of medical insurance, FSA, HSA, and COBRA 
  • Ability to understand how to utilize technology and phone systems
  • Ability to identify and provide solutions for client needs
  • Quick learner and detailed oriented
  • Strong communication skills, complemented by both excellent verbal and written communication
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Word and Excel
